esp-idf/components/soc/esp32c5/mp/include/soc/gpio_sig_map.h
laokaiyao a56b575535 feat(esp32c5mp): add soc files part 1
The files in this part are auto generated
2024-03-05 16:18:02 +08:00

247 lines
12 KiB
C

/*
* SPDX-FileCopyrightText: 2024 Espressif Systems (Shanghai) CO LTD
*
* SPDX-License-Identifier: Apache-2.0
*/
#pragma once
#define EXT_ADC_START_IDX 0
#define LEDC_LS_SIG_OUT0_IDX 0
#define LEDC_LS_SIG_OUT1_IDX 1
#define LEDC_LS_SIG_OUT2_IDX 2
#define LEDC_LS_SIG_OUT3_IDX 3
#define LEDC_LS_SIG_OUT4_IDX 4
#define LEDC_LS_SIG_OUT5_IDX 5
#define U0RXD_IN_IDX 6
#define U0TXD_OUT_IDX 6
#define U0CTS_IN_IDX 7
#define U0RTS_OUT_IDX 7
#define U0DSR_IN_IDX 8
#define U0DTR_OUT_IDX 8
#define U1RXD_IN_IDX 9
#define U1TXD_OUT_IDX 9
#define U1CTS_IN_IDX 10
#define U1RTS_OUT_IDX 10
#define U1DSR_IN_IDX 11
#define U1DTR_OUT_IDX 11
#define I2S_MCLK_IN_IDX 12
#define I2S_MCLK_OUT_IDX 12
#define I2SO_BCK_IN_IDX 13
#define I2SO_BCK_OUT_IDX 13
#define I2SO_WS_IN_IDX 14
#define I2SO_WS_OUT_IDX 14
#define I2SI_SD_IN_IDX 15
#define I2SO_SD_OUT_IDX 15
#define I2SI_BCK_IN_IDX 16
#define I2SI_BCK_OUT_IDX 16
#define I2SI_WS_IN_IDX 17
#define I2SI_WS_OUT_IDX 17
#define I2SO_SD1_OUT_IDX 18
#define CPU_TESTBUS0_IDX 19
#define CPU_TESTBUS1_IDX 20
#define CPU_TESTBUS2_IDX 21
#define CPU_TESTBUS3_IDX 22
#define CPU_TESTBUS4_IDX 23
#define CPU_TESTBUS5_IDX 24
#define CPU_TESTBUS6_IDX 25
#define CPU_TESTBUS7_IDX 26
#define CPU_GPIO_IN0_IDX 27
#define CPU_GPIO_OUT0_IDX 27
#define CPU_GPIO_IN1_IDX 28
#define CPU_GPIO_OUT1_IDX 28
#define CPU_GPIO_IN2_IDX 29
#define CPU_GPIO_OUT2_IDX 29
#define CPU_GPIO_IN3_IDX 30
#define CPU_GPIO_OUT3_IDX 30
#define CPU_GPIO_IN4_IDX 31
#define CPU_GPIO_OUT4_IDX 31
#define CPU_GPIO_IN5_IDX 32
#define CPU_GPIO_OUT5_IDX 32
#define CPU_GPIO_IN6_IDX 33
#define CPU_GPIO_OUT6_IDX 33
#define CPU_GPIO_IN7_IDX 34
#define CPU_GPIO_OUT7_IDX 34
#define USB_JTAG_TDO_IDX 35
#define USB_JTAG_TRST_IDX 35
#define USB_JTAG_SRST_IDX 36
#define USB_JTAG_TCK_IDX 37
#define USB_JTAG_TMS_IDX 38
#define USB_JTAG_TDI_IDX 39
#define CPU_USB_JTAG_TDO_IDX 40
#define USB_EXTPHY_VP_IDX 41
#define USB_EXTPHY_OEN_IDX 41
#define USB_EXTPHY_VM_IDX 42
#define USB_EXTPHY_SPEED_IDX 42
#define USB_EXTPHY_RCV_IDX 43
#define USB_EXTPHY_VPO_IDX 43
#define USB_EXTPHY_VMO_IDX 44
#define USB_EXTPHY_SUSPND_IDX 45
#define I2CEXT0_SCL_IN_IDX 46
#define I2CEXT0_SCL_OUT_IDX 46
#define I2CEXT0_SDA_IN_IDX 47
#define I2CEXT0_SDA_OUT_IDX 47
#define PARL_RX_DATA0_IDX 48
#define PARL_TX_DATA0_IDX 48
#define PARL_RX_DATA1_IDX 49
#define PARL_TX_DATA1_IDX 49
#define PARL_RX_DATA2_IDX 50
#define PARL_TX_DATA2_IDX 50
#define PARL_RX_DATA3_IDX 51
#define PARL_TX_DATA3_IDX 51
#define PARL_RX_DATA4_IDX 52
#define PARL_TX_DATA4_IDX 52
#define PARL_RX_DATA5_IDX 53
#define PARL_TX_DATA5_IDX 53
#define PARL_RX_DATA6_IDX 54
#define PARL_TX_DATA6_IDX 54
#define PARL_RX_DATA7_IDX 55
#define PARL_TX_DATA7_IDX 55
#define FSPICLK_IN_IDX 56
#define FSPICLK_OUT_IDX 56
#define FSPIQ_IN_IDX 57
#define FSPIQ_OUT_IDX 57
#define FSPID_IN_IDX 58
#define FSPID_OUT_IDX 58
#define FSPIHD_IN_IDX 59
#define FSPIHD_OUT_IDX 59
#define FSPIWP_IN_IDX 60
#define FSPIWP_OUT_IDX 60
#define FSPICS0_IN_IDX 61
#define FSPICS0_OUT_IDX 61
#define PARL_RX_CLK_IN_IDX 62
#define PARL_RX_CLK_OUT_IDX 62
#define PARL_TX_CLK_IN_IDX 63
#define PARL_TX_CLK_OUT_IDX 63
#define RMT_SIG_IN0_IDX 64
#define RMT_SIG_OUT0_IDX 64
#define RMT_SIG_IN1_IDX 65
#define RMT_SIG_OUT1_IDX 65
#define TWAI0_RX_IDX 66
#define TWAI0_TX_IDX 66
#define TWAI0_BUS_OFF_ON_IDX 67
#define TWAI0_CLKOUT_IDX 68
#define TWAI0_STANDBY_IDX 69
#define TWAI1_RX_IDX 70
#define TWAI1_TX_IDX 70
#define TWAI1_BUS_OFF_ON_IDX 71
#define TWAI1_CLKOUT_IDX 72
#define TWAI1_STANDBY_IDX 73
#define EXTERN_PRIORITY_I_IDX 74
#define EXTERN_PRIORITY_O_IDX 74
#define EXTERN_ACTIVE_I_IDX 75
#define EXTERN_ACTIVE_O_IDX 75
#define PCNT_RST_IN0_IDX 76
#define GPIO_SD0_OUT_IDX 76
#define PCNT_RST_IN1_IDX 77
#define GPIO_SD1_OUT_IDX 77
#define PCNT_RST_IN2_IDX 78
#define GPIO_SD2_OUT_IDX 78
#define PCNT_RST_IN3_IDX 79
#define GPIO_SD3_OUT_IDX 79
#define PWM0_SYNC0_IN_IDX 80
#define PWM0_OUT0A_IDX 80
#define PWM0_SYNC1_IN_IDX 81
#define PWM0_OUT0B_IDX 81
#define PWM0_SYNC2_IN_IDX 82
#define PWM0_OUT1A_IDX 82
#define PWM0_F0_IN_IDX 83
#define PWM0_OUT1B_IDX 83
#define PWM0_F1_IN_IDX 84
#define PWM0_OUT2A_IDX 84
#define PWM0_F2_IN_IDX 85
#define PWM0_OUT2B_IDX 85
#define PWM0_CAP0_IN_IDX 86
#define PWM0_CAP1_IN_IDX 87
#define PWM0_CAP2_IN_IDX 88
#define GPIO_EVENT_MATRIX_IN0_IDX 89
#define GPIO_TASK_MATRIX_OUT0_IDX 89
#define GPIO_EVENT_MATRIX_IN1_IDX 90
#define GPIO_TASK_MATRIX_OUT1_IDX 90
#define GPIO_EVENT_MATRIX_IN2_IDX 91
#define GPIO_TASK_MATRIX_OUT2_IDX 91
#define GPIO_EVENT_MATRIX_IN3_IDX 92
#define GPIO_TASK_MATRIX_OUT3_IDX 92
#define CLK_OUT_OUT1_IDX 93
#define CLK_OUT_OUT2_IDX 94
#define CLK_OUT_OUT3_IDX 95
#define SIG_IN_FUNC_97_IDX 97
#define SIG_IN_FUNC97_IDX 97
#define SIG_IN_FUNC_98_IDX 98
#define SIG_IN_FUNC98_IDX 98
#define SIG_IN_FUNC_99_IDX 99
#define SIG_IN_FUNC99_IDX 99
#define SIG_IN_FUNC_100_IDX 100
#define SIG_IN_FUNC100_IDX 100
#define PCNT_SIG_CH0_IN0_IDX 101
#define FSPICS1_OUT_IDX 101
#define PCNT_SIG_CH1_IN0_IDX 102
#define FSPICS2_OUT_IDX 102
#define PCNT_CTRL_CH0_IN0_IDX 103
#define FSPICS3_OUT_IDX 103
#define PCNT_CTRL_CH1_IN0_IDX 104
#define FSPICS4_OUT_IDX 104
#define PCNT_SIG_CH0_IN1_IDX 105
#define FSPICS5_OUT_IDX 105
#define PCNT_SIG_CH1_IN1_IDX 106
#define MODEM_DIAG0_IDX 106
#define PCNT_CTRL_CH0_IN1_IDX 107
#define MODEM_DIAG1_IDX 107
#define PCNT_CTRL_CH1_IN1_IDX 108
#define MODEM_DIAG2_IDX 108
#define PCNT_SIG_CH0_IN2_IDX 109
#define MODEM_DIAG3_IDX 109
#define PCNT_SIG_CH1_IN2_IDX 110
#define MODEM_DIAG4_IDX 110
#define PCNT_CTRL_CH0_IN2_IDX 111
#define MODEM_DIAG5_IDX 111
#define PCNT_CTRL_CH1_IN2_IDX 112
#define MODEM_DIAG6_IDX 112
#define PCNT_SIG_CH0_IN3_IDX 113
#define MODEM_DIAG7_IDX 113
#define PCNT_SIG_CH1_IN3_IDX 114
#define MODEM_DIAG8_IDX 114
#define PCNT_CTRL_CH0_IN3_IDX 115
#define MODEM_DIAG9_IDX 115
#define PCNT_CTRL_CH1_IN3_IDX 116
#define MODEM_DIAG10_IDX 116
#define MODEM_DIAG11_IDX 117
#define MODEM_DIAG12_IDX 118
#define MODEM_DIAG13_IDX 119
#define MODEM_DIAG14_IDX 120
#define MODEM_DIAG15_IDX 121
#define MODEM_DIAG16_IDX 122
#define MODEM_DIAG17_IDX 123
#define MODEM_DIAG18_IDX 124
#define MODEM_DIAG19_IDX 125
#define MODEM_DIAG20_IDX 126
#define MODEM_DIAG21_IDX 127
#define MODEM_DIAG22_IDX 128
#define MODEM_DIAG23_IDX 129
#define MODEM_DIAG24_IDX 130
#define MODEM_DIAG25_IDX 131
#define MODEM_DIAG26_IDX 132
#define MODEM_DIAG27_IDX 133
#define MODEM_DIAG28_IDX 134
#define MODEM_DIAG29_IDX 135
#define MODEM_DIAG30_IDX 136
#define MODEM_DIAG31_IDX 137
#define ANT_SEL0_IDX 138
#define ANT_SEL1_IDX 139
#define ANT_SEL2_IDX 140
#define ANT_SEL3_IDX 141
#define ANT_SEL4_IDX 142
#define ANT_SEL5_IDX 143
#define ANT_SEL6_IDX 144
#define ANT_SEL7_IDX 145
#define ANT_SEL8_IDX 146
#define ANT_SEL9_IDX 147
#define ANT_SEL10_IDX 148
#define ANT_SEL11_IDX 149
#define ANT_SEL12_IDX 150
#define ANT_SEL13_IDX 151
#define ANT_SEL14_IDX 152
#define ANT_SEL15_IDX 153
#define SIG_GPIO_OUT_IDX 256
// version date 2311280